METHOD AND SYSTEM FOR CELL RENDERING AND MANIPULATION

A method and system for an active cell rendering engine (700), including a web server, a rendering engine (703), an application layer (711), and a data layer (713). The application layer (711) includes cell applications (705). The data layer (713) has data sources (707) corresponding to the cell app...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: BOWMAN, JOHN, F., JR, DEFENSOR, DENNIS, G
Format: Patent
Sprache:eng ; fre
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:A method and system for an active cell rendering engine (700), including a web server, a rendering engine (703), an application layer (711), and a data layer (713). The application layer (711) includes cell applications (705). The data layer (713) has data sources (707) corresponding to the cell applications (705). One of the cell application (705) is started pursuant to a request from the rendering engine (703), and returns formatted data, based on the data source (707) in the data layer (713), to the rendering engine (703). The rendering engine (703), responsive to a copy request, provides a copy of one of the cell applications (705) to another page. The copied cell application (705) includes a reference back to the page, so that modifications to the page appear in the copied cell application in a real-time fashion. Users can thus copy cells to pages, and construct pages utilizing copied cells, in order to keep real-time updated content in a cell on a page. The application layer (711) and data layer (713) can be provided in a configuration separate from the web server and rendering engine (703). L'invention concerne un procédé et un système portant sur un moteur de rendu de cellules actives, y compris un serveur web, un moteur de rendu, une couche application et une couche données. La couche application a des sources de données correspondant aux applications de cellules. Une des applications de cellules, lancée suivant une demande du moteur de rendu, renvoie à ce moteur des données formatées, sur la base de la source de données dans la couche données. Le moteur de rendu, réagissant à une demande de copie, fournit à l'autre page une copie de l'une des applications de cellules. L'application de cellules copiée comporte un renvoi à la page, les modifications apportées à la page apparaissant donc, en temps réel, dans l'application de cellules copiée. Les utilisateurs peuvent ainsi copier des cellules sur des pages, et réaliser des pages à l'aide de cellules copiées, afin de conserver, en temps réel, un contenu actualisé dans une cellule sur une page. La couche application et la couche données peuvent être produites dans une configuration indépendante du serveur web et du moteur de rendu.